- [ ] Step 7: Archive cold storage buckets (Glacierline tier). Confirm both ceremony witnesses are present, verify bucket manifests match the Oxbow ledger, then seal the archive key shares. Plugin authors may observe but not handle shares. Once sealed, the archive index itself is encrypted and can only be reopened with the passphrase below.

vault phrase of badup-hahig = tamael-aldael-kelmir-istael-fenok-istwyn-tamius-jorath-oliion

## 3.9.0 — Changed defaults

Deep-link routing in Wayfarer Mobile now defaults to the universal-link resolver instead of the custom scheme handler. Links without a registered route fall back to the web view rather than failing silently. Existing installs pick up the change on next launch; no app-store review required. The router ships with the following default configuration:

service settings:
[casix]
port = 7000
team = belix
host = casix.xolmardata.internal
region = east-1
access_code = ac_714b3a
timeout_ms = 1500

**Q: How does the Ledgerlook audit-log viewer handle retention and redaction?**

Ledgerlook reads append-only events from the Vantry store and never mutates them; redaction is implemented as an overlay applied at render time, so the underlying record stays intact. Retention is ninety days in the hot tier, then archival. Maintainers should never bypass the overlay layer, even for debugging. The data model, overlay rules, and archival schedule are documented on the page below.

wiki page, yageg-bajep: https://grafana.qirvanworks.internal/dash/dash/view/6d73e7380646

Subject: Retirement of the Cindertrack Product Line

Executive team, this note is primarily for our incoming director, Halden Mroos. We will retire the Cindertrack line over the next three quarters. Support continues for existing customers through contract end; no new sales after this quarter. Migration paths to Ashgrove Pro are documented. Engineering capacity frees up in Q3. Context on how this fits our forward plans follows below.

confidential, kagup-bafog: Fraaxax Group is in early talks to buy Soroxox Group for about $343.8 million. The Olidor launch date is June 14, and nothing goes to the press before then. Legal wants the Aldmirek Logistics term sheet signed before July 23.